No, but I can see why the confusion.
It was a straight armbar. A kimura attacks the shoulder joint and in order to do it effectively you have to bend the elbow and McCorkle wasn't able to. He then did the smart thing and adjusted the way he was attacking the arm and by stretching the arm and keeping the grip it puts pressure on the elbow joint, hence why it was an armbar and not a kimura.
